Output 399cd80573604eb2081577b6ca83817bccd91796ca7c4e5d230001758adf4efc:1

value
46650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18a34c75650d2a1ed67bdee5d1dafa8583e76266 OP_EQUAL
address
33wHmLZ3yBHYhq5d1WxdGqxQLF19RCopMD
transaction
399cd80573604eb2081577b6ca83817bccd91796ca7c4e5d230001758adf4efc
spent
true